Test Description

Water contamination in the fuel system may cause driveability conditions such as hesitation, stalling, no start or misfires in one or more cylinders. Water may collect near a single fuel injector at the lowest point in the fuel injection system and cause a misfire in that cylinder. If the fuel system is contaminated with water, inspect the fuel system components for rust or deterioration.

Ethanol concentrations of greater than 10 percent can cause driveability conditions and fuel system deterioration. Fuel with more than 10 percent ethanol could result in driveability conditions such as hesitation, lack of power, stalling or no start. Excessive concentrations of ethanol used in vehicles not designed for it may cause fuel system corrosion, deterioration of rubber components and fuel filter restriction.
